BLC Levels of Leadership Informative Essay.docx - The purpose of this essay is to discuss the three levels of leadership in the Army. ... WebDiversity: Increased minority recruits by 3% over FY18. Active Army female enlistments are the highest they have been since 2004. Army Reserve female enlistments are the highest they have been since before the early 1990s. Geography: The Army focused on 22 key cities and improved enlistments by an average of 15%. sharm day trips
